The Eurocom line of Panther Mobile Workstations and Mobile Servers is designed for CAD/CAM designers, engineers, and architects who must frequently travel, yet need access to powerful computing.

Eurocom Panther series is a workstation-class notebook powered by six-core Intel processors and NVIDIA SLI with two GeForce GTX 480M or NVIDIA Quadro FX 5000M.

There are two models available: the EUROCOM Panther 2.0 and EUROCOM D900F Panther. Having 24GB of triple channel memory means fast processing, smooth multi tasking and virtualization, according to the company.
